Trio held for harassing girl 7 caught begging

KUWAIT CITY, Aug 26:  Jahra securitymen arrested three youths for harassing a girl inside a famous commercial complex in the governorate.
After receiving a call from the girl, securitymen rushed to the location and arrested the youths.  The officers also summoned the youths’ parents and asked them to sign a pledge to guide their children properly.

Youth caught drunk: Securitymen arrested a 22-year-old man in Salmiya for consuming alcohol.
The officers asked the young man to stop for inspection after noticing the erratic movement of his vehicle while they were patrolling the area.  When they demanded for his identification documents, the officers realized the young man was under the influence of alcohol.  He was taken to a nearby police station for prosecution.

7 beggars held: Securitymen arrested seven beggars, including two women, inside the mosques in the Capital and Hawally governorates Thursday.
Security sources said two of those arrested entered the country on visit visas.  Sources added the seven beggars were referred to the concerned department for the necessary legal action.

Police officer insulted:  A security officer filed a complaint against a Kuwaiti, who allegedly insulted him while he was on duty in Farwaniya Thursday.
According to the officer, he asked the Kuwaiti to stop for inspection but the latter refused to present his identification documents and shouted expletives at him, so he lodged a complaint against the citizen.
A case was registered and investigations are underway to verify the officer’s claim.
